Photographer Writes Book To Benefit Animal Shelter

“How Dogs Make Cloud Pictures”.

Worcester, MA (USA), October 22, 2014 — Sheri Bready recently combined her passion for photography and dogs for a good cause. She wrote a book to benefit the Worcester Animal Rescue League (WARL) called “How Dogs Make Cloud Pictures.” Released by Halo Publishing International, the book contains photographs of imaginative dog scenes with pets that are waiting for adoption.

“I wanted to use my photography for more than just making money,” says the Worcester photographer and author. “I wanted people to know in a creative way that these animals need homes.”

Inspired by her own two dogs, Bready says she always wonders what they are thinking. The front cover of the book displays a dog staring at the sky. The clouds look like a bone and a ball, giving the idea that if a dog made a cloud picture it would probably look like this.

“Sheri is a talented photographer and this book showcases her innovative ideas,” says Halo Publisher Lisa M. Umina. “But this book is more than just about Sheri’s creativity, it’s also an avenue to build awareness about pet adoption and raise funds for the no-kill shelter where she serves as a volunteer.”

Founded 1912, WARL has been dedicated to the care of animals as a private, non-profit organization. Staff and volunteers work tirelessly with foster homes, rescues groups and shelters nationwide to provide the best possible home. The costs for care, medicine, food, shelter, spray and neuter, training and prep for adoption far outweigh the costs the organization takes in for fees. Generous donors supply the rest of the funds.

Relationship Expert Says “Like Yourself – Like Your Marriage”

Speaks on Self Worth While Releasing Second Book.

Mora, MN (USA), October 22, 2014 — Lisa Cassman, a licensed counselor, author, ordained minister and speaker, says men and women need to learn how to like themselves. She says liking yourself makes all the difference in any relationship, especially marriage. She recently wrote her second relationship book, “The Light in Your Eyes,” published by Halo Publishing International. It’s a poetic journey with her husband.

“When you learn who you are, you can learn to like yourself, then you can give more in a relationship instead of taking all the time,” says Cassman. “When both a husband and spouse can learn to do this successfully they can have a happier marriage.”

Research shows that self esteem is a huge issue globally, especially in women. One study shows only 4% of women think of themselves as beautiful, while 80% of women agree that every woman has something about her that is beautiful but do not see their own beauty.

Cassman says these stats are a product of what’s really going on inside of woman – her self worth. She knows because she also struggled growing up with low self-esteem and self worth. That’s why she speaks and writes from her own experience through sexual abuse, and a struggling marriage that ended in divorce. Through her faith and learning to like herself, she received healing. Now she’s married to the man of her dreams.

In her self-worth seminars, Cassman gives keys to help others find out what causes low self-worth and avenues toward solutions, while also encouraging attendees to draw on their faith for healing.

“Lisa’s seminars and books weave a dynamic story of brokenness to wholeness, which helps others to do the same in their personal lives and marriages,” says Halo Publisher Lisa M. Umina.

Annual “Open” (No Theme) Online Art Competition Announced

Light Space & Time Online Art Gallery announces a call for entries for the gallery’s 4th Annual “Open” Juried Art Competition for the month of November 2014. (There is no theme for this competition)

Jupiter, FL, USA (October 24, 2014) — Light Space & Time Online Art Gallery announces a call for entries for the gallery’s 4th Annual “Open” Juried Art Competition for the month of November 2014. The gallery encourages entries from artists, regardless of where they reside to apply to this competition by submitting their best representational and non-representational art (There is no theme for this competition).

A group exhibition of the top ten finalists will be held online at the Light Space & Time Online Art Gallery during the month of December 2014. Awards will be for 1st through 5th places. Also, 5 Honorable Mention places will be awarded. In addition, depending on the amount and the quality of the entries, Special Merit and Special Recognition awards will also be given as well. The submission process and the deadline will end on November 27, 2014.
